Abstract
In this paper various analytical and numerical aspects of the dissipative
nonlinear Schr¨odinger equation (d-NLS equation) are discussed. Decaying solitary wave
type solutions derived by Demiray is reviewed and a new approximate solitary wave
type solution of the d-NLS equation is introduced in order to make comparisons. Also a
split-step Fourier scheme is proposed for numerical solution of the d-NLS equation and
the analytical solutions are compared with the numerical results.
